      Eh, these chatbots can do some wild things once their context window fills up, which is trivial to do if you’re talking to it for 10 fucking hours a day. If you try and reference something that has fallen out of its context window, it won’t just stop and tell you “I don’t remember what you’re talking about”, it’ll uhhh, fill in the gaps. Keep going long enough and the context window will be mostly hallucinations and hallucinations of hallucinations, all building on one another until it starts talking metaphysical mumbo jumbo at you and telling you where to meet your soulmate.
